Summary, notice description and lot information
The Hampshire and Isle of Wight Healthcare NHS Foundation Trust has completed the procurement process for the "Talking therapies 3rd Party Provision Call off" under the Provider Selection Regime (PSR) Regulations 2023. This contract was awarded without competition, as part of an existing agreement, and will facilitate community health services within the Southampton region (UKJ32). The process, confirmed through a contract notice on 8th July 2025, involves a six-month contract valued at £249,087.

Provision of 3rd Party Talking Therapies provision at Step 3. This notice is confirmation of an award having been made based on a framework agreement and without competition. The contract is approximately PS249,087 in total value and lasts 6 months. <br/>This an existing service with an existing provider.
